SEMH Teaching Assistant
Location: Croydon, CR7
Commutable Areas: Sutton, Bromley, Lewisham, Merton, Lambeth
Day Rate: £90-£105 per day
Contract: Long-term to permanent
Hours: Monday to Friday, 8:30 AM - 3:30 PM
Start Date: ASAP
Are you passionate about making a real difference by providing dedicated 1:1 support to a child with SEMH needs?
Join a 'Good' Ofsted-rated primary school in Croydon, known for its supportive, well-led environment for children aged 3-7.
This Teaching Assistant role focuses on providing 1:1 support to a Year 2 student with Social, Emotional, and Mental Health (SEMH) needs.
You will help them access the curriculum and develop crucial social and emotional skills within a nurturing Early Years setting, contributing to a diverse and ambitious school community. This is an excellent SEMH Teaching Assistant role for the right person.
Key Responsibilities
Deliver tailored 1:1 emotional and behavioural support, building a strong rapport.
Implement and adapt learning activities to aid curriculum access and emotional growth for SEMH learners.
Collaborate with the teacher and SENDCo on student progress and support strategies.
Foster a positive, inclusive classroom environment for the student's SEMH requirements.What We're Looking For
Qualifications: A relevant Level 3 qualification (or equivalent) is advantageous for this Teaching Assistant vacancy.
Experience: Proven experience working with children with SEMH, complex needs, or SEND (Special Educational Needs). Early Years experience is beneficial.
Soft Skills: Empathy, patience, resilience, strong communication, and ability to connect with young learners.Why Work with Long Term Futures?
